Citrix XenServer, jak rozszerzy

Konfiguracja serwerów, usług, itp.
poldas
Beginner
Posty: 105
Rejestracja: 12 grudnia 2006, 08:51

Citrix XenServer, jak rozszerzyć wielkość partycji?

Post autor: poldas »

Witam.

Mam zainstalowanego Debiana na Citrix XenServer, do którego mam montowany dysk (/dev/xvdb1) z zasobów, którymi dysponuje XenServer. Powiększyłem wielkość wolumenu (100GB -> 200GB) w XenServerze, ale Debian oczywiście widzi zasób w starym rozmiarze. Jak bezpiecznie (nie tracąc danych) rozszerzyć przestrzeń zasobu do maksymalnej wielkości?

Kod: Zaznacz cały

/dev/xvdb1           100790004  95375132    294960 100% /var/informatyka
Z góry dziękuję za pomoc.
Awatar użytkownika
Redhead
Junior Member
Posty: 526
Rejestracja: 17 lipca 2007, 17:37

Post autor: Redhead »

To tak nie działa, ze ci się automatycznie rozszerzy. Miejsce dodane, nie zaalokowane bedzie na dysku /dev/xvdb1.
Jak

Kod: Zaznacz cały

partprobe /dev/xvdb1
nie pokaże ci miejsca, to można jeszcze restart zrobić.
Wtedy już napewno bedzie widac. Tylko w fdisk dobrze popatrz na wartość Blocks
poldas
Beginner
Posty: 105
Rejestracja: 12 grudnia 2006, 08:51

Post autor: poldas »

Nie do końca rozumiem w jaki sposób mam rozszerzyć partycję, restart nic nie zmienił.
Awatar użytkownika
Bastian
Member
Posty: 1424
Rejestracja: 30 marca 2008, 16:09
Lokalizacja: Poznañ

Post autor: Bastian »

Nie bardzo się znam na Xenie od Citrixa, ale czy po takim zabiegu nie trzeba zrobić

Kod: Zaznacz cały

resize2fs -p /dev/partycja_docelowa
?
poldas
Beginner
Posty: 105
Rejestracja: 12 grudnia 2006, 08:51

Post autor: poldas »

Bastian pisze:Nie bardzo się znam na Xenie od Citrixa, ale czy po takim zabiegu nie trzeba zrobić

Kod: Zaznacz cały

resize2fs -p /dev/partycja_docelowa
?

Kod: Zaznacz cały

neptun:~# resize2fs -p /dev/xvdb1
resize2fs 1.41.3 (12-Oct-2008)
The filesystem is already 25599569 blocks long.  Nothing to do!
Awatar użytkownika
Redhead
Junior Member
Posty: 526
Rejestracja: 17 lipca 2007, 17:37

Post autor: Redhead »

Wiesz co, pokaż

Kod: Zaznacz cały

fdisk -l /dev/xvdb
poldas
Beginner
Posty: 105
Rejestracja: 12 grudnia 2006, 08:51

Post autor: poldas »

Kod: Zaznacz cały

Disk /dev/xvdb: 213.8 GB, 213842395136 bytes
255 heads, 63 sectors/track, 25998 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Disk identifier: 0xd3db69dd

    Device Boot      Start         End      Blocks   Id  System
/dev/xvdb1               1       12748   102398278+  83  Linux
neptun:~#

Awatar użytkownika
Redhead
Junior Member
Posty: 526
Rejestracja: 17 lipca 2007, 17:37

Post autor: Redhead »

No to masz ponad 200GB partycje. I poszerzenie partycji sie udało.
Jedna partycja ma 12748 cylindrow, a caly dysk ma 25998.
Wchodzisz do fdiska i robisz /dev/xvdb2, albo co tam chcesz.
poldas
Beginner
Posty: 105
Rejestracja: 12 grudnia 2006, 08:51

Post autor: poldas »

Może źle zadałem pytanie, chciałbym rozszerzyć rozmiar partycji xvdb1 do maksymalnego rozmiaru dysku xvdb.
Awatar użytkownika
Redhead
Junior Member
Posty: 526
Rejestracja: 17 lipca 2007, 17:37

Post autor: Redhead »

Kierunek parted.
ODPOWIEDZ